What is the POS Experience?

The POS experience refers to the entire process by which employees and customers interact with the point-of-sale system in a food service environment. This experience directly impacts a restaurant's daily operational efficiency while profoundly influencing the customer's overall dining experience.

1.1 The POS Experience from the Employee Perspective

For employees, a positive all in one POS experience means having an intuitive and reliable system that enables core processes like order taking, payment processing, and order management to run smoothly and accurately. When staff trust their tools, their productivity increases significantly, allowing them to focus more fully on delivering exceptional customer service.

1.2 POS Experience from the Customer Perspective

From the customer's viewpoint, the POS experience is as crucial as delicious food and a comfortable dining environment. Customers expect fast, seamless transactions—whether splitting bills, making payments, or confirming order accuracy—with no friction or hassle.

1.3 Core Elements Influencing POS Experience

· System Speed and Stability: Efficient, stable systems ensure smooth transaction flows.

 

· Intuitive Interface: User-friendly interfaces enable quick adaptation and use by both staff and customers.

 

· Diverse Payment Methods: Extensive payment options meet varied customer needs and enhance transaction flexibility.

Why is a good POS experience important for restaurants?

A superior POS experience delivers dual benefits—empowering staff, delighting customers, and driving tangible business growth.

1.Boosts staff efficiency and morale

A responsive, user-friendly POS system reduces workload. Faster order taking, automated inventory management, and seamless integration with kitchen display systems reduce manual tasks. This efficiency lowers employee stress, boosts team morale, creates a more positive work .

2.Boost Customer Satisfaction and Loyalty

Customers expect a frictionless dining experience, where the POS system plays a pivotal role. Swift payment processing, flexible payment options, and accurate order fulfillment minimize wait times. Satisfied customers are more likely to return, leave positive reviews, and recommend the restaurant. Over time, this cultivates customer loyalty—repeat customers spend more and become brand advocates.

3.Driving Revenue Growth

A seamless POS experience directly impacts profitability. Efficient checkout accelerates table turnover, enabling more customers to be served per shift. Loyalty programs integrated with the POS system encourage repeat visits and increased spending. Furthermore, customer data collected through POS interactions can be leveraged for targeted marketing, further boosting sales.

Common Challenges in POS Experiences

Every restaurant faces certain challenges when using a POS system. Understanding these issues can help you address them more effectively. Here are some common problems:

· System Slowdowns:

During busy lunch rushes, POS system lag causes significant disruptions. This delay impacts order-taking speed and overall service efficiency, leading to increased customer wait times and heightened staff stress. It may trigger negative reviews and reduce customer return rates.

· Complex Interface:

An ideal POS system should be intuitive and user-friendly. However, many systems feature overly complex interfaces requiring extensive staff training. New employees struggling with operations reduce transaction efficiency and increase error rates, frustrating both staff and customers.

· Limited Payment Options:

In the digital age, customers expect diverse payment methods. If your POS system only supports cash or traditional credit cards, you risk losing customers who prefer newer payment options like mobile wallets or contactless payments. Expanding payment options not only improves the checkout experience but also broadens your customer base.

Addressing these common POS experience issues can optimize operational workflows and enhance the customer dining experience. Proactively upgrading your system is a critical investment that ensures your restaurant stays ahead of the competition while meeting the demands of modern consumers.

Five Key Strategies to Enhance the POS Experience

1. Upgrade Hardware Equipment

First, assess the condition of your existing POS hardware. Outdated devices often experience lag and crashes, especially during peak business hours. Replacing them with newer, faster, and more reliable hardware reduces downtime, speeds up transactions, and enables staff to serve customers more efficiently.

2. Simplify the User Interface

Complex interfaces slow down staff during peak hours. Streamlining the POS system's UI with intuitive layouts and clear instructions reduces training costs for new hires, minimizes order processing errors, and enables staff to handle busy periods with ease.

3. Optimize Payment Workflows

Streamlining and accelerating payment is key to enhancing customer experience. Selecting a POS system that supports mobile payments, contactless payments, and traditional card swiping reduces customer wait times and increases table turnover during peak hours. Secure and convenient payment options also build customer trust and elevate their overall experience.

4. Integrate with Core Tools

Connecting the POS system to digital tools like online ordering platforms simplifies operations and reduces steps for staff when processing orders. Synchronizing multi-channel orders directly into the system not only lowers error rates and accelerates service speed but also collects more comprehensive customer data, supporting targeted marketing and service optimization.

5. Ensure Robust Customer Support

High-quality service from POS vendors is crucial for swiftly resolving system issues, minimizing disruptions to restaurant operations. Selecting vendors that offer 24/7 support and proactive maintenance helps restaurants handle unexpected situations during critical periods, ensuring service continuity.

Shaping the Future POS Experience Through Technological Innovation

Modern POS systems are equipped with a range of innovative features that deliver superior experiences for both staff and customers, driving a revolution in restaurant management models.

1. Touchscreen Functionality

Leading POS systems utilize intuitive touchscreen interfaces that streamline ordering and payment processes. Staff operate more efficiently without frequent navigation through complex menus, significantly accelerating service speed. Simultaneously, the touchscreen's user-friendliness makes training new employees easier and more effective.

2. Mobile Compatibility

Mobile compatibility breaks the usage constraints of traditional POS systems. Through mobile POS apps, servers can process payments directly at customers' tables, reducing wait times and enhancing service quality. This flexibility is particularly suited for restaurants during peak hours, as well as those with outdoor patios or expanded service scenarios like catering events.

3. Customer Data Analytics

The POS system's data analytics capabilities enable restaurants to track customer preferences, order histories, and spending habits. Leveraging this data, establishments can deliver personalized service and implement targeted marketing strategies. Data-driven decision-making effectively boosts customer satisfaction and encourages repeat business.

4. Innovative Smart Ordering Solutions

· Self-Service Kiosks

Self-service kiosks empower customers with full control over the ordering process, enhancing order accuracy and service speed. This self-service model is particularly suited for tech-savvy customers and effectively reduces staff workload during peak hours.

 

· QR Code Ordering

Integrating QR code menus into service workflows allows customers to view digital menus on their smartphones via scanning. This efficient method reduces physical contact, enhancing customer safety and convenience.

 

· Table-Side Ordering

Using handheld POS devices, servers can take orders and process payments directly at the customer's table. This technology improves order accuracy, adds a personalized touch to the dining experience, and helps boost customer satisfaction and table turnover.

By integrating these smart ordering solutions, you can ensure your restaurant stays at the forefront of technology, making every interaction between staff and customers smoother and more enjoyable.

Choosing the Right POS System for Your Restaurant

When choosing a POS system, it is essential to consider its scalability to ensure the system can be upgraded as your business grows. Opt for a system that not only meets current needs but also offers integration capabilities with new technologies and expandable features, safeguarding future technology investments. Additionally, seek suppliers that provide robust support and updates to ensure the system remains relevant as your business evolves.
